Subject: Hiring Freeze — Coastal Logistics Division

Executive Team,

Effective Monday, all open requisitions within the Coastal Logistics division at Marrowfield Group are paused pending the Q3 cost review. Finance has flagged a 14% overrun against the staffing plan, driven largely by contractor conversions in the Dunmore hub. Backfills for safety-critical roles may proceed with CFO sign-off only. A revised headcount model follows next week. The note below summarizes the strategic rationale.

confidential, kagep-kahof: Druokax Systems plans to lower the Ulaath list price by 53 percent in March.

**Ticket PKT-88: Webhook fires twice on parcel handoff**

For whoever inherits this: the Cartwheel parcel-tracking webhook double-fires when a package moves from the Delven hub to a courier within the same minute. Downstream, Merrow's notifier then texts customers twice. Root cause looks like a missing idempotency check in the handoff event coalescer. Repro steps attached. The offending deploy is identified by the token below.

trace token, hawep-hadug: htk3_9c2

Handover Note — Customer Concentration Risk

To my successor: please read this carefully before the branch managers' call. Ostrel Logistics now accounts for 41% of regional revenue, up from 28% last year. Their renewal lands in March, and any delay would strain cash flow at the Fenwick and Darrow branches. I have begun diversification outreach with three mid-size prospects; the pipeline tracker has details. Branch managers should prioritize these leads. The agreed mitigation approach is stated below.

internal memo for kawip-hadug: Headcount on the Wenwyn team goes from 7 to 140 by the end of January. Gross margin on Wenwyn came in at 20 percent against a plan of 15 percent.

## Service Account: relevance-tuner

For this week's eng sync: the search relevance tuning notes are generated nightly by the `svc-relevance` account on the Querymill cluster. It replays sampled queries, computes ranking deltas, and writes annotated results to the tuning dashboard. Changes to scoring weights must go through review before deployment.

The account authenticates to the metrics ingest service with the key below.

app token of yahif-fahap = vxb3-3pr